Many people are hesitant to install a cat flap because they don't want to ruin their door. However, with a little basic knowledge, the task is easy. The first step is to find the dimensions of your pet, and then measure their height from the bottom of the belly. This is the minimum height that you need to cut into the door panel.
Find the center of the flat surface at the bottom of the door panel using an x. Then using a fine-toothed handheld handsaw or jigsaw blade make the hole you need in the panel. Make sure you use the correct saw for this kind of work. Always remember'measure twice cut twice'.
A circular hole is preferred over a square one because it is less likely that the glass will crack in the near future. If you're worried about drilling into toughened glass you can always employ the services of an experienced glazier.
It is best to fit a pet flap into a solid UPVC door panel right from the outset, rather than trying to install it on an existing UPVC window or double-glazed doors with a glass pane. This will avoid any damage to the door that is not needed and save you money in the long term.

There are a variety of cat flaps. The most basic form of cat flap is a two way swinging door. Your cat can gently push it in either direction to enter or leave. This is the least expensive type of cat flap but it's not the most secure. It could allow other cats to access your home. A cat flap that is lockable is a different option. You'll need use a key or code to allow your cat in and out. This is more secure and could aid in preventing burglars from gaining entry to your home through the door.
You can put a uPVC panel with a cat flap in your door that you already have or change to a double glazed sealed unit. A specialist will have to cut a hole through the glass to install a cat flap on an old door. It is easier and more affordable to buy a new glass unit or door with a pre-made flap hole.

If your uPVC door has a glass pane in the bottom, you can install a cat flap without having to replace the whole door panel. You can request your glazier to cut a hole into the bottom part of the door and then install an opening for a cat flap. This is a good option if you are renting your property and want to be in a position to move the door after you leave.
It is important to remember that installing a cat flap on a full-length UPVC panel could be unattractive and drafty. It also poses an security risk, as an intruder could flick the handle inside the cat flap to open the door if the door is not double-locked. It is recommended to set the cat flap into an insert with a half-panel that is flat.
